Kyle Larson Calls Out NASCAR Playoff Format: “We Could Win 20 Races and Still Lose the Championship”

The 2024 NASCAR Cup Series season saw Team Penske continue their dominance, securing yet another Bill France Cup in controversial fashion. But for Kyle Larson, the format that decides the champion is deeply flawed—a system where consistency and season-long dominance mean nothing if you don’t win the finale.

Despite winning more races than any other driver, Larson was denied his second championship, as Team Penske peaked at the perfect moment in the playoffs to steal the title. And now, Larson isn’t holding back on his frustrations.

“You Can Win 20 Races and Still Lose the Championship”

In an interview with NASCAR on FOX, Larson addressed the elephant in the room—the flawed nature of NASCAR’s playoff system, which prioritizes a single race over an entire season’s performance.

“The format is really difficult, and when it comes down to just one race at the end, there’s an opportunity that it can happen. I think we could win 20 races in a year and still not win the championship.”

For Larson, the playoff format doesn’t reward the best driver over a full season—instead, it rewards whoever gets hot at the right time.

Penske’s Phoenix Advantage: NASCAR’s Biggest Problem?

Larson also pointed out why Team Penske has thrived under the current format—they own Phoenix Raceway, where the championship race is held.

“I wouldn’t be surprised because the [Team Penske] cars are just so dominant at [Phoenix Raceway]. If nothing changes, I think, anytime a Penske car makes the Final 4 at Phoenix, they’re gonna have the best opportunity to win currently.”

With NASCAR’s refusal to change the playoff structure, Larson expects Penske to continue their reign—and unless you can beat them at Phoenix, it doesn’t matter how dominant you were all season.

Can Larson Move On? “Having One Championship Helps”

For Larson, losing in 2024 was frustrating, but he admits that having already won the 2021 title makes it easier to accept.

“If I didn’t have a championship already, I would say no, I wouldn’t be good with that. I think having a championship already allowed me to get over it more this past season.”

But that doesn’t mean he’s happy about it. His comments make it clear:

  • If NASCAR doesn’t make changes, a driver could dominate all year and still walk away empty-handed.
  • Penske’s advantage at Phoenix makes it harder for other teams to win under the current system.
  • The frustration is real—and if nothing changes, Larson might find himself in the same situation again.

Will NASCAR Listen?

Larson’s comments echo a growing frustration among fans and drivers alike. Many believe the current format devalues the season and makes the championship feel more like a lottery than a true test of dominance.

Will NASCAR adjust the system to reward season-long excellence, or will the playoff controversy continue?

One thing is certain—Kyle Larson isn’t staying quiet about it.
